I am excited and honored to be running New York City Marathon on behalf of the Brave Like Gabe Foundation and to raise money for rare cancer research.

All of the women in my family have battled cancer… endometrial cancer, colon cancer, breast cancer, esophageal cancer. The disease has also impacted my step-dad and uncles. Because of research, improvements in screening and treatments have increased the chances of survival. But that’s not the case for all cancer patients.

I learned about Gabe’s battle with a rare cancer through my running coach. I followed her journey as she trained between treatments. I would spot her on the roads and trails around Minneapolis and was always a little too nervous to say ‘hi.” But seeing her running brought so much inspiration.

For more on her story, check out this documentary.

After her passing, we saw how many people she inspired. From high school cross country athletes in her hometown of Perham, Minnesota to the world’s best marathoners and pro teammates, many now continue her legacy to “run on hope.”
